Key Steps to Take When Filing for a Late Shipment Refund

Once you identify a late shipment, there are a few key steps to take to claim a late shipment refund. First, gather all documents and data related to the shipment, including shipping invoices, order confirmation emails, and any other documents related to the shipment. Secure digital copies of these documents and store them in a central location for easy access in case of future disputes. Then, review shipping company policies regarding late shipment refunds. Familiarize yourself with the criteria for eligibility and deadlines for filing claims to make sure that you do not miss any critical deadlines.

When you are ready to file for a late shipment refund, make sure that you have all the necessary information to submit your request. Provide detailed and accurate information to support your claim, including a shipment tracking number, delivery date, and the reason for the delay. Include any evidence of the delay, such as screenshots of the tracking information, emails, or other documentation supporting your claim. Be sure to submit all necessary documentation and file your claim before the deadline to avoid forfeiting your potential refund.

Strategies to Minimize the Impact of Late Shipments on Your Business

Even if you do everything right, you may experience late shipments. To minimize their impact on your business, you should consider implementing these strategies:

  • Offer timely and proactive communication with customers affected by late shipments, letting them know that special efforts are being made to correct the issue.
  • Consider offering incentives, such as discounts or free shipping to customers affected by late shipments to compensate for their inconvenience and demonstrate your commitment to customer satisfaction.
  • Implement order shipping buffers, add 1 or 2 days to expected delivery time to reflect transit time changes. This builds in an added layer of flexibility to your shipping schedule and minimizes the impact of late shipments.

Tips for Monitoring and Measuring the Success of Your Late Shipment Refund Program

The success of your late shipment refund program depends on how well you monitor and measure it. Here are some tips:

  • Track the number of late shipments and refunds claimed and the recovery rates over time.
  • Regularly review any denied claims and evaluate how you can increase the chances of success in future claims.
  • Survey customers regarding their satisfaction with your shipping process and use their feedback to guide process improvements.
  • Analyze shipping data and the root causes of delays to identify trends and areas for improvement.
